Expanding ignition IGBT lineup
ROHM's ignition IGBTs have been used for gasoline system of vehicles, motor cycles and industry applications.
Power train systems require less fuel consumption. Ignition systems directly affect the reduction of CO2 emissions, hence switching loss and robustness for ignition IGBT become more important.
ROHM's RGP series achieved low saturation voltage and high avalanche energy by improving the tradeoff performance.
Features
- Package:TO-252 (DPAK), TO-263S (D2PAK)
- BVCES=360V ~560V
- Low Saturation Voltage typ. 1.6V
- Avalanche Energy:250mJ~500mJ (Tj=25℃)
- Built-in ESD protection Diode for Gate
- Built-in Resistor between Gate and Emitter (Option)
- Based upon AEC-Q101

650V and 1200V automotive qualified switching IGBTs
650V switching IGBTs which are suitable for inverter applications have been released.
One of the main automotive application is the e-compressor.
ROHM's RGS series guarantees enough short circuit withstand time.
Also the integration of a freewheeling diode into one package contributes to space saving.
Recently higher voltage battery tends to be equipped with advanced EV and PHEV cars to extend driving range.
Therefore 1200V lineup will be followed.
Features
- Narrow trench pitch & Thin wafer technology (2nd gen.)
- Short circuit withstand time : 8-10μs min.
- Low switching loss & Low switching noise
- Low gate charge
- Built in very fast & Soft recovery FRD (Fast recovery diode)
- Based upon AEC-Q101
